## SECTION 1: Marbles — WITHOUT Replacement

Bag contains:
- Green = 2
- Brown = 9
- Yellow = 7
- Blue = 4
Total marbles = 2 + 9 + 7 + 4 = 22

Since marbles are not replaced, the total number of marbles decreases after each draw.

---

1. P(brown, then yellow)



- P(first brown) = 9/22
- After removing one brown, total marbles = 21, yellow still = 7
- P(yellow second) = 7/21 = 1/3

P = (9/22) × (7/21) = (9/22) × (1/3) = 9/66 = 3/22

Answer: 3/22

---

2. P(green, then blue)



- P(green first) = 2/22 = 1/11
- After removing green, total = 21, blue = 4
- P(blue second) = 4/21

P = (2/22) × (4/21) = (1/11) × (4/21) = 4/231

Answer: 4/231

---

3. P(yellow, then yellow)



- P(first yellow) = 7/22
- After removing one yellow, yellow left = 6, total = 21
- P(second yellow) = 6/21 = 2/7

P = (7/22) × (6/21) = (7/22) × (2/7) = 14/154 = 1/11

Answer: 1/11

---

4. P(blue, then blue)



- P(first blue) = 4/22 = 2/11
- After removing one blue, blue left = 3, total = 21
- P(second blue) = 3/21 = 1/7

P = (4/22) × (3/21) = (2/11) × (1/7) = 2/77

Answer: 2/77

---

5. P(green, then NOT blue)



- P(green first) = 2/22 = 1/11
- After removing green, total = 21
- NOT blue = all except blue → 21 - 4 = 17 (since 4 blue remain)
→ P(not blue second) = 17/21

P = (2/22) × (17/21) = (1/11) × (17/21) = 17/231

Answer: 17/231

---

6. P(brown, then NOT green)



- P(brown first) = 9/22
- After removing brown, total = 21
- NOT green = 21 - 2 = 19 (green still 2, since we removed a brown)

→ P(not green second) = 19/21

P = (9/22) × (19/21) = 171/462

Simplify: divide numerator and denominator by 3 → 57/154

Answer: 57/154

---

## SECTION 2: Marbles — WITH Replacement

Now, marble is replaced, so total remains 22 for every draw.

---

7. P(brown, then yellow)



- P(brown) = 9/22
- P(yellow) = 7/22

P = (9/22) × (7/22) = 63/484

Answer: 63/484

---

8. P(green, then blue)



- P(green) = 2/22 = 1/11
- P(blue) = 4/22 = 2/11

P = (2/22) × (4/22) = (1/11) × (2/11) = 2/121

Answer: 2/121

---

9. P(yellow, then yellow)



- P(yellow) = 7/22 both times

P = (7/22) × (7/22) = 49/484

Answer: 49/484

---

10. P(blue, then blue)



- P(blue) = 4/22 = 2/11 both times

P = (4/22) × (4/22) = (2/11) × (2/11) = 4/121

Answer: 4/121

---

11. P(green, then NOT blue)



- P(green) = 2/22 = 1/11
- P(not blue) = 1 - P(blue) = 1 - 4/22 = 18/22 = 9/11

P = (2/22) × (18/22) = (1/11) × (9/11) = 9/121

Answer: 9/121

---

12. P(brown, then NOT green)



- P(brown) = 9/22
- P(not green) = 1 - P(green) = 1 - 2/22 = 20/22 = 10/11

P = (9/22) × (20/22) = 180/484

Simplify: divide by 4 → 45/121

Answer: 45/121

---

## SECTION 3: Die and Spinner

- Die: 6-sided → outcomes 1,2,3,4,5,6 → each has prob 1/6
- Spinner: 4 equal regions: A, B, C, D → each has prob 1/4
- Events are independent → multiply probabilities

---

13. P(4 and A)



- P(4 on die) = 1/6
- P(A on spinner) = 1/4

P = (1/6) × (1/4) = 1/24

Answer: 1/24

---

14. P(even number and C)



Even numbers on die: 2,4,6 → 3 out of 6 → P(even) = 3/6 = 1/2
P(C) = 1/4

P = (1/2) × (1/4) = 1/8

Answer: 1/8

---

15. P(2 or 5 and B or D)



- P(2 or 5) = 2/6 = 1/3
- P(B or D) = 2/4 = 1/2

P = (1/3) × (1/2) = 1/6

Answer: 1/6

---

16. P(a number less than 5 and B, C, or D)



Numbers less than 5: 1,2,3,4 → 4 out of 6 → P = 4/6 = 2/3
B, C, or D → 3 out of 4 → P = 3/4

P = (2/3) × (3/4) = 6/12 = 1/2

Answer: 1/2

---

## SECTION 4: M&Ms — WITHOUT Replacement (eaten)

Bag contains:
- Red = 5
- Brown = 3
- Yellow = 6
- Blue = 2
Total = 5+3+6+2 = 16

Marbles are eaten → no replacement

---

17. P(brown, then yellow, then red)



- P(brown first) = 3/16
- After brown removed: total = 15, yellow = 6 → P(yellow) = 6/15 = 2/5
- After yellow removed: total = 14, red = 5 → P(red) = 5/14

P = (3/16) × (6/15) × (5/14)

Calculate step by step:

= (3/16) × (2/5) × (5/14) [since 6/15 = 2/5]

Notice 5 cancels: (3/16) × (2/1) × (1/14) = (3×2)/(16×14) = 6/224 = 3/112

Answer: 3/112

---

18. P(red, then red, then blue)



- P(red first) = 5/16
- After red removed: red = 4, total = 15 → P(red) = 4/15
- After another red: total = 14, blue = 2 → P(blue) = 2/14 = 1/7

P = (5/16) × (4/15) × (2/14)

= (5/16) × (4/15) × (1/7)

Multiply numerators: 5×4×1 = 20
Denominators: 16×15×7 = 1680

→ 20/1680 = 1/84

Answer: 1/84

---

19. P(yellow, then yellow, then not blue)



- P(yellow first) = 6/16 = 3/8
- After yellow: yellow = 5, total = 15 → P(yellow) = 5/15 = 1/3
- After second yellow: total = 14, blue = 2 → not blue = 12 → P(not blue) = 12/14 = 6/7

P = (6/16) × (5/15) × (12/14)

= (3/8) × (1/3) × (6/7)

Cancel 3: (1/8) × (1) × (6/7) = 6/56 = 3/28

Answer: 3/28

---

20. P(brown, then brown, then not red)



- P(brown first) = 3/16
- After brown: brown = 2, total = 15 → P(brown) = 2/15
- After second brown: total = 14, red = 5 → not red = 9 → P(not red) = 9/14

P = (3/16) × (2/15) × (9/14)

Multiply numerators: 3×2×9 = 54
Denominators: 16×15×14 = 3360

→ 54/3360

Simplify: divide numerator and denominator by 6 → 9/560

Answer: 9/560

---
